WebMar 10, 2024 · Nursing care plans for patients who underwent cholecystectomy include promoting optimal respiratory function, preventing complications, management of pain, and provision of information about … WebLaparoscopic cholecystectomy is minimally invasive surgery to remove the gallbladder. It helps people when gallstones cause inflammation, pain or infection. The surgery involves a few small incisions, and most people go home the same day and soon return to normal activities. WebAug 29,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ebThe definitive treatment for cholecystitis is cholecystectomy, which is surgical removal of the gallbladder. If surgery can’t be performed, an alternative treatment option is gallbladder drainage, either percutaneously or via ERCP.
